Lone Star Grillz “Smoked Pulled Chicken”
Remember to always wash your hands prior to preparing. Use food grade gloves where appropriate to prevent contamination.
Recipe and Ingredients:
- 4 lbs. trimmed Chicken Breasts
- Lone Star Grillz “South of the Border” Rub (or your favorite rub)
- 2 chopped Onions
- 2 chopped Bell Peppers
- 1 sliced Jalapeno
- 3 cloves chopped Garlic
- 2 cups Chicken Broth
- A few drops of your favorite Hot Sauce
- 2 Tbsp. Olive Oil
DIRECTIONS:
1) Unpackage and trim the Chicken Breasts.
2) Generously coat them on ALL sides with Lone Star Grillz “South of the Border” Rub (or your favorite Rub).
3) Place Onions, Bell Peppers, Jalapeno, Garlic into foil pan, coat with Olive Oil, season with LSG “South of the Border” Rub, mix well.
4) Add Chicken Broth and a few drops of your favorite Hot Sauce to pan.
The Cook: Approximate time 3-4 hours total
Pre-heat your Lone Star Grillz Pellet Smoker to 275 degrees Fahrenheit. Once fully preheated, place chicken on top grate and foil pan on bottom grate underneath the chicken.
Allow it to cook for approximately 1 hour or until the chicken hits 160°F in the center. Place the chicken in the foil pan with the veggies and cover it with foil then get it back on the smoker at the same temperature.
Approximately 90 minutes later the chicken will be pull apart tender. Pull it apart, mix with veggies and cover with foil again, than get it back on the smoker for 30-60 minutes to absorb the flavors in the pan.
Remove it from the smoker, rest and cool for a few minutes, serve with as tacos, sandwiches or just by itself.. ENJOY!
